I.O.O.F.

STAR OF WAIKIWI LODGE.

The star of Waikiwi Lodge .No. 95 held its fortnightly meeting in the Waikiwi Public Hall on Thursday, September 29, the gavel being in the hands of N.G. Bro. H. Campbell, who presided over an attendance of 45 members and visitors.

A letter was received from the secretary of The Southland District Lodge No. 4 notifying that the Star of. Waikiwi Lodge was successful in winning the initiatory competition for the year 1932. Various letters of congratulation were received from the other lodges in the Central Jurisdiction.

The election of officers resulted in V.G. Bro. W. C. Erickson being elected to the principal chair. Bro. W. Connors was elected Vice-Grand, P.G. Bro. I. Logan was elected Recording Secretary, and P.G. Bro. R. C. Buckingham was elected treasurer for the current term. A vote of confidence was then taken for the financial secretary, P.G. Bro. E. M. Fraser, and found in his favour.

The secretary was instructed to notify the D.D.G.M. asking him to be present at the next meeting for the purpose of carrying out the installation of officers. The Noble Grand welcomed visitors from Loyal Pioneer of Southland and Aroha Lodges and White Flower Encampment, the visiting brethren suitably responding. After the meeting the members adjourned to the social room where a pleasant hour was spent. Items were contributed by Bros. T. Fraser, W. Connors, M. D. Joyce, J. Aspray and P.G. Bro. P. Baldwin.
